STRENGTHS
  • Scourge of starfighters: The CR125 Corvette was designed specifically to combat enemy starfighters, which it does quite effectively with its 8 Dual H-s1 Heavy Laser Cannons
  • Carrier: The CR125 carries a small complement of starfighters into battle
  • Field of fire: The positioning of the CR125's weapons allows the vessel to combat multiple targets simultaneously
  • Versatile: The CR125 is capable of fulfilling a variety of different roles with the Mahporeem fleet
  • Heavy armor: Compared to the CR90, the CR125 is more heavily armored
WEAKNESSES
  • Poor ship to ship combatant: Though the CR125 is highly capable against ships of a similar size, it struggles when facing larger vessels such as cruisers and Star Destroyers
  • Turbolaserless: This issue is even more apparent due to the removal of all turbolasers from the vessel's arsenal
  • Broadside: The positioning of the CR125's weapons makes the vessel most effective when engaging targets from the side. Anything in front or behind the CR125 can attack the corvette without having to deal with most of its weapon systems
  • Vulnerable hangar: The hangar on the CR125 is rather prominent, making it an enticing target for enemy ships
  • Slower: Compared to the CR90, the CR125 is slower to move and slower to turn
DESCRIPTION

During its production run, the CR90 Corvette was quite possibly the most common starship in existence, being used throughout the entire galaxy. Pirates, smugglers, mercenaries, planetary defense forces, rebels and even the Galactic Empire all found use for these rugged and versatile ships. Mahporeem was no exception, and had a large number of CR90s in its defense fleet when the Galactic Empire fell.

Being in desperate need of capital ships, Mahporeem made extensive modifications to these corvettes, outfitting them with forward facing hangars, redesigned engines and a host of different weapon systems, such as laser cannons, ion cannons and concussion missile launchers. Dubbed "CR125" Corvettes, these vessels quickly gained a reputation for being highly effective against both starfighters and other similarly sized ships, thanks to the broad layout of their weapon systems.

However, this came at a cost, as the removal of the CR125's turbolaser batteries made it far less effective against larger ships such as cruisers and Star Destroyers. Nonetheless, CR125s continue to play an important role with the Mahporeem Navy, and are able to fulfill a number of functions that allow larger ships to be better used elsewhere.
